St George’s University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ust, in partnership with Kingston Hospital NHS Foundation Trust, is seeking a full-time Substantive Consultant ENT Surgeon with a specialist interest in otology and lateral skull base surgery. The post involves delivering complex tertiary care at St George’s Hospital, contributing to general ENT services at Kingston Hospital, and working within a hub-and-spoke network serving South West London.
The successful candidate will join the Lateral Skull Base MDT, collaborating with neurosurgery, audiology, radiology, and oncology colleagues, performing advanced otology and skull base procedures, and supporting service development, audit, and teaching. Leadership, mentorship, and academic engagement are also key aspects of the role.
This is an excellent opportunity to develop subspecialist expertise, contribute to high-quality, patient-centred care, and shape ENT services across the region.
The post holder will provide a comprehensive Otology and Lateral Skull Base service across St George’s Hospital and Kingston Hospital. Key duties include delivering specialist inpatient, day case and outpatient care, and contributing to the multidisciplinary skull base service at St George’s.
The appointee will support the development of the otology and skull base service, including participation in audit, clinical governance, service planning, and maintenance of surgical and national databases.
At Kingston Hospital, the post holder will deliver otology clinics and middle ear surgery, work collaboratively with audiology services, and contribute to general ENT outpatient and day case activity.
The role also includes participation in emergency ENT care and on-call duties, providing senior clinical support when required.
In addition, the post holder will provide leadership, teaching, and mentorship to junior medical staff and the wider multidisciplinary team, while actively contributing to training, appraisal, and continuous professional development.
